MORTGAGEE LETTER 2005-02. TO: ALL APPROVED MORTGAGEES. ALL APPROVED APPRAISERS. SUBJECT: Seller Concessions and Verification of Sales . This Mortgagee Letter reiterates and clarifies federal housing administration (fha) policy regarding the responsibilities of mortgagees and appraisers in reporting sales concessions and verification of sales data.

This blog post is part of an ongoing series in which we answer common questions relating to the FHA mortgage insurance program. Today’s question is: With FHA loans, can the seller pay the buyer’s closing costs? The short answer is yes. The Department of Housing and Urban Development, which manages the FHA loan program, allows sellers to contribute money toward the home buyer’s closing costs.
